Feds Back Plan To Turn Roads In Jackson Park Into Open Park Space Ahead Of Obama Center’s Arrival – Block Club Chicago

The park received federal funds in the early 1980s in exchange for the city’s commitment to promoting recreation in the park. As a result, federal officials must approve any plan to remove or replace recreational space in Jackson Park, as the Obama Center plans would.
